[PHP-users 22623]Re: ファイルのアップロード時の所有権について
竹澤秀一
s-takezawa @ tokimec.co.jp
2004年 7月 16日 (金) 11:57:03 JST
こんにちは、いつもお世話になっています。
竹澤です。
PHPからアップロードされたファイルの所有者はPHPが実行されているユーザが指定されます。
まあ、早い話が「Apacheの起動ユーザと同じ」になります。
Uploadファイルの所有者が固定であるならば、Apacheの起動ユーザ名を変更すればOKかも。
(セキュリティ上問題が無いのが前提だが。。。)
複数ユーザに振り分けたいなら、ftp関連のコマンドを使ったほうが良い様な気もします。
ちなみに、Apacheのデフォルト起動ユーザNobodyでchownやchmodなどを行うと、怒られますが、
Apacheの起動ユーザを変更し、それなりの権限を付加すれば、chownやchmodを行うことができます。
ただ、その場合のリスクなどはきっちり計算してください。
[PHP-users 17828]所有者権限の変更をしたい があった。
http://ns1.php.gr.jp/pipermail/php-users/2003-September/018357.html
では、がんばってください。
------------------------------
TIS
竹澤 秀一
81-1413
s-takezawa @ stff.tokimec.co.jp
------------------------------
PHP-users メーリングリストの案内